Fellowship 14 International Photography Competition

Silver Eye Center for Photography has announced the call for entries for Fellowship 14, its international photography competition. Now in its 14th year, this competition recognises both rising talent and established photographers. You may submit up to ten (10) images from a cohesive, exhibition-ready body of work created within the past three years. Award recipients will be selected by the juror on the basis of exceptional, distinctive talent as evidenced by the strength of their submitted portfolios. The juror is especially interested in seeing portfolios with a strong narrative thrust and highly individual, original points of view. The deadline for entries is Monday 21 October 2013, 11:59:59 pm EST.

Judge
Linda Benedict-Jones is Curator of Photography at Carnegie Museum of Art in Pittsburgh, PA. Prior to this, Linda served as the Executive Director of Silver Eye Center for Photography from 1999 to 2008 and has also served as Curator of Education at The Frick Art & Historical Center (Pittsburgh, PA). Linda earned a Master's Degree in Visual Studies from Massachusetts Institute of Technology in 1982 and has taught courses in photography at a number of universities including the London College of Printing, England; Harvard Extension School; and Carnegie Mellon University.
